Hexafret and Stellantis put cars on trains in France

Image: Shutterstock. © HJBC

Hexafret, the successor of Fret SNCF, established a new rail freight service on behalf of Stellantis to move their cars between their factory in Mulhouse and the port of Toulon, in southern France. The service runs four times a month.
